Aircraft Description

N175LW is a Curtis A Langholz MURPHY REBEL, a single-engine reciprocating (piston) aircraft registered to Langholz Curtis A in Orting, WA. The registration certificate was issued on March 29, 2022. The registration is set to expire on March 31, 2029. The aircraft is configured with 3 seats. The aircraft's Mode S transponder code is A12CCF (hex), used for ADS-B identification and flight tracking. The FAA registry record for N175LW was last updated on July 22, 2023.
